#b1d3b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1d3b5 is composed of 69.4% red, 82.7%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 127.1 degrees, a saturation of 27.9% and a lightness of 76.1%. #b1d3b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63a76b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

● #b1d3b5 color description : Grayish lime green.
#b1d3b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1d3b5 has RGB values of R:177, G:211,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 11654069.
